احصل على السعرAustin SAG model SAGMILLING.COM. Jtotal is the mill total volumetric filling as a fraction (eg. 0.30 for 30%) εB is the porosity of the rock and ball load (use 0.3) wC is the charge %solids, fraction by weight (use 0.80 Doll, 2013) Jballs is the mill volumetric filling of balls as a fraction (eg. 0.10 for 10%)get price

احصل على السعر2021-9-16 Ball Filling Percentage For Sag Mill. Jan 01, 2015 The ball charge is a function of the bulk fraction of the SAG mill volume (Jb) occupied by balls; the ore retained in the mill is the result of the volumetric filling which depends on the ore size distribution (specially the % +6″ and the % −6″ +1″), on the rotational speed (N/Nc) and on the solid concentration by weight fraction
